Company Pre-Closing Tax Liability definition

Company Pre-Closing Tax Liability means any (i) Company Pre-Closing Liability or Excluded Liability related to (A) Taxes, (B) a Tax Claim or (C) a violation of Legal Requirements related to Taxes and (ii) any Losses of any type whatsoever arising from, out of, or related to, a breach of the representations and warranties in Sections 5.8 or 7.6.
